Output dd90963c24d429792583865e2047696b8ae447dc4504c1df122b4febd10b5d60:1

value
3955429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a233c5f7cedbf31fff1d1700e5079c645ff20ee OP_EQUALVERIFY OP_CHECKSIG
address
1DbQThfbSe89fAjvVQxKNhVs96j8jMxzPx
transaction
dd90963c24d429792583865e2047696b8ae447dc4504c1df122b4febd10b5d60
spent
true